Social Security in Nepal refers to the protection provided by the government to individuals in times of need, such as in cases of old age, disability, maternity, and unemployment. The main aim of Social Security is to ensure a minimum standard of living for all citizens and to promote social well-being.
There are various situations where you may need legal help with Social Security in Nepal, such as applying for benefits, appealing a decision, understanding your rights, navigating complex laws and regulations, and ensuring you receive the benefits you are entitled to.
Key aspects of Social Security laws in Nepal include provisions for old-age pensions, disability benefits, maternity benefits, and unemployment benefits. The Social Security Act and related regulations govern the administration and implementation of these benefits.
